Exploring Cell Biology in the Realm of Biology Research

Cell biology, a cornerstone of modern biology, delves into the structure, function, and interactions of individual cells, the fundamental building blocks of life. As research assistants, we play a crucial role in supporting the scientific community's efforts to understand cellular phenomena.

The Role of a Biology Research Assistant

Biology research assistants contribute to a variety of tasks that help advance cell biology. Their responsibilities often include:

  • Assisting in laboratory experiments and field studies
  • Collecting and analyzing data
  • Maintaining laboratory equipment and supplies
  • Conducting literature searches
  • Preparing reports and presentations
  • Collaborating with other researchers
  • Operating laboratory equipment, including chemical reagents.

Key Aspects of Cell Biology

Some essential concepts of cell biology include:

  • Cell structure: The organization of a cell's components, such as the nucleus, membrane, organelles, and cytoskeleton, which influence cellular functions.
  • Cell division: The process of forming new cells from existing ones, including mitosis and meiosis.
  • Cell signaling: The means by which cells communicate and interact with one another through the exchange of signaling molecules.
  • Cell adhesion: The process by which cells attach to one another or to their extracellular environment.
  • Cell transport: The movement of substances across the cell membrane, including passive and active transport mechanisms.

Cell Biology Techniques and Methods

Research assistants must be proficient in various techniques and methods used in cell biology, such as:

  • Microscopy: Light and electron microscopy to observe cellular structures and processes at different scales.
  • Biochemistry: Techniques to study cellular components, such as proteins and nucleic acids.
  • Cell culture: Methods for growing cells in controlled environments, such as flasks or bioreactors.
  • Immunofluorescence: A technique used to visualize proteins within cells or tissues.
  • Live cell imaging: Techniques to observe cells in real-time, such as time-lapse microscopy.
